Brief Bio

Dr. Kristopher Croome is a Professor of Surgery at Mayo Clinic Florida. He has fellowship training in both Transplantation (ASTS) and HPB surgery (AHPBA). He also has a graduate degree in epidemiology and statistics from Harvard University. He is currently an Associate Editor for the Journal: Liver Transplantation. His research interests include donation after circulatory death liver transplantation, donor liver steatosis, liver regeneration and hepatobiliary oncology. He has over 100 peer-reviewed publications in transplant and HPB surgery. Outside of work he enjoys spending time with his wife Sarah and children Xander, Charlotte and Emma.
